The global fiberglass fabric market is expected to grow with a CAGR of 6.1% from 2026 to 2035. The fiberglass fabric market in Germany is also forecasted to witness strong growth over the forecast period. The major drivers for this market are the increasing demand for lightweight materials, the rising adoption in the automotive industry, and the growing need for fire-resistant fabrics.

The future of the fiberglass fabric market in Germany looks promising with opportunities in the wind energy, transportation, electrical & electronic, construction, marine, and aerospace & defense markets.
  • Within the type category, e-glass will remain a larger segment over the forecast period.
  • Within the application category, wind energy is expected to witness the highest growth.

The challenges in the fiberglass fabric market in Germany are:

  • Fluctuating Raw Material Prices: The cost of raw materials such as silica, resin, and other chemicals used in fiberglass production is highly volatile due to global supply chain disruptions, geopolitical tensions, and fluctuating oil prices. These fluctuations impact manufacturing costs and profit margins, forcing companies to adjust pricing strategies. Price instability can hinder long-term planning and investment, potentially slowing market growth. Manufacturers must develop strategies to mitigate risks associated with raw material price volatility to maintain competitiveness.
  • Environmental Concerns and Recycling Challenges: Despite the push for sustainability, fiberglass production generates waste and emissions that pose environmental challenges. Recycling fiberglass fabrics remains complex and costly, limiting the industry’s ability to adopt fully circular practices. Regulatory pressures to reduce environmental impact require significant investments in cleaner technologies and recycling infrastructure. These challenges can increase operational costs and slow innovation, creating barriers for market players aiming to meet environmental standards while maintaining profitability.
  • Regulatory Compliance and Certification: Stringent regulations governing safety, environmental impact, and product standards in Germany and the European Union require manufacturers to obtain various certifications and adhere to strict guidelines. Compliance involves high costs and time investments, which can delay product launches and increase operational expenses. Smaller players may struggle to meet these requirements, leading to market consolidation. Navigating complex regulatory landscapes remains a critical challenge for sustaining growth and innovation in the fiberglass fabric industry.
